Africa should not support UN because of the racism that appears in their meetings. The UN has been a biased organization since its creation. Even though the UN is said to promote human rights and peace all over the world, its approach and how the UN actually functions remains very questionable and discriminatory. In fact, only five countries have the right to use a veto which would annul any resolution the Security Council comes up with. This is a big whole in the functioning of the UN, since these five countries can do anything they want without fearing being subject to any kind of sanctions from the UN. In fact they are at the same time parties and judges.
